UPDATED: Missing Burke County Teen Located In Richmond County
According to Sgt. Dan Lowe, the Burke County Sheriff’s Office needs assistance from the public in locating a runaway juvenile. The juvenile is identified as 14-year-old Clarissa Mack, who is described as being 5’5” tall, and weighing 130 pounds. Update: Mack has since been found in Richmond County.
***12:00 p.m. Update August 3rd***
Clariss Mack has been located in Richmond County.
